Symptoms
  • Sudden or gradual appearance of flat areas of normal-feeling skin with complete pigment loss

Signs and tests

Examination is usually sufficient to confirm the diagnosis. In some cases, a skin biopsy may be needed to rule out other causes of pigment loss. Your doctor may also perform blood tests to check the levels of thyroid or other hormones, and vitamin B12 levels.
